Iheanacho Fit for Celtic’s Europa League Clash with Utrecht

Celtic manager Martin O’Neill has confirmed that Kelechi Iheanacho is fit and available for selection ahead of Thursday’s UEFA Europa League clash against Utrecht at Celtic Park.
The Nigerian striker, who joined the Scottish champions in September on a free transfer after leaving Sevilla, had made a promising start to life in Glasgow with three goals and one assist in ten appearances before a hamstring injury sidelined him.
His absence saw him miss ten matches during a difficult festive period for Celtic, further limiting their attacking options.
Providing an update on his recovery, O’Neill said Iheanacho has returned to full training and is ready to feature in the crucial European tie.
‘Yes, he has trained and he is available for selection,’ the coach told reporters.
The injury also ruled Iheanacho out of the Africa Cup of Nations, despite his inclusion in Nigeria’s 54-man provisional squad in December.
Now back in contention, the former Leicester City forward will be eager to make his mark at Celtic Park and help the club secure a positive result that could see them advance to the knockout stage of the Europa League.
